%mibnameshort% shows 1.3.6.1.2.1.1.3.0 instead of sysUpTime

Hi,

I have SNMP tests that check uptime and I use %mibnameshort% in the NamePattern.
In 9.x (I’m not sure when it changed) %mibnameshort% showed “sysUpTime� .
In 10.20 and 10.30 %mibnameshort% shows “1.3.6.1.2.1.1.3.0� which is the same as %object%.

Is this a bug?

Custom Menu Items

Here are some of my favorite Custom Menu Items: Menu item: Remote Desktop 1280x800 Command line: mstsc.exe /v:%hostaddrb% /w:1280 /h:800 Menu item: Putty -ssh host Command line: putty -ssh %hostaddrb% Menu item: Start Service Command line: sc.exe \\%hostaddrb% start "%ServiceName%" Menu it...
